Old Red

I got to work early on Tuesday to shoot a group photo at Old Red on the campus of The University of Texas Medical Branch in Galveston. I was so early no one was there yet, so while I waited for people to arrive, I took a couple of shots before the sun rose over the hospital, off camera right. This plaza is filled with mid-day light, so working here is a challenge -- either with portraits or architectural shots. You can see the top left roofline just starting to get hit with a little sunlight even at 7:15 am. Three handheld frames merged together with Nik HDR Efex Pro, 18mm at f/6.3.
